Most bought real estate stocks in Q2 2025

See which Real Estate stocks institutional investors increased the most in Q2 2025, measured as net growth in reported share positions from Q1 2025 into Q2 2025. Notable additions at the top of this list include REDFIN CORP (RDFN), COSTAR GROUP INC (CSGP), RLJ LODGING TRUST (RLJ), HUDSON PACIFIC PROPERTIES IN (HPP). These rankings aggregate SEC 13F filings from all institutional investors in our database.

Frequently asked questions about Most bought real estate stocks in Q2 2025

  • What are the most bought Real Estate stocks in Q2 2025?

    The most bought real estate stocks in Q2 2025 are those with the largest increase in reported share counts across institutional investors compared to Q1 2025, based on SEC 13F filings.

  • Which real estate stocks did institutional investors added to the most in Q2 2025?

    Among filers in this sector, net additions were largest in companies such as REDFIN CORP (RDFN), COSTAR GROUP INC (CSGP), RLJ LODGING TRUST (RLJ), based on aggregated 13F data.

  • How is institutional buying calculated?

    Buying is calculated by summing the net increase in shares reported by institutional investors between two consecutive quarterly 13F snapshots (compared to Q1 2025).

  • Does this include all institutional owners?

    Yes. These rankings aggregate SEC 13F filings from all institutional investors in our database, not only the investors we track individually.

  • Are these trades real-time?

    No. 13F filings are reported quarterly and may be delayed by up to 45 days. The data reflects positions at the end of the reporting period, not real-time trading activity.
